Taw qhia
Nyob rau hauv hluav taws xob tsheb thermal tswj systems, actuators xws li hluav taws xob dej twj, roj twj, thiab cov kiv cua txias feem ntau ua hauj lwm nyob rau hauv high-kub thiab high-kev co ib puag ncig. Cov tsoos txhuas electrolytic capacitors yog nquag tswj board malfunctions thiab txawm system tsis ua hauj lwm vim nce ESR thiab tsis txaus ripple kam rau ua.
YMIN Solution
Capacitors muaj electrolyte qhuav thiab oxide txheej degradation nyob rau hauv high-temperature ib puag ncig, ua rau muaj zog ESR, capacitance degradation, thiab to tam sim no. Tshwj xeeb tshaj yog nyob rau hauv high-frequency switching fais fab mov, ripple tam sim no-induced cua sov ntxiv accelerates kev laus.
Lub VHE series siv cov txheej txheem tom ntej polymer hybrid dielectric thiab electrode qauv tsim kom ua tiav:
Tsawg ESR: VHE series tshiab tswj hwm tus nqi ESR ntawm 9-11 mΩ (zoo dua li VHU nrog qhov hloov pauv tsawg), uas ua rau poob qis qis thiab ua haujlwm zoo ib yam.
High Ripple Current Capacitance: VHE series 'ripple tam sim no tuav lub peev xwm yog tshaj 1.8 npaug siab dua VHU, txo qis zog poob thiab tsim hluav taws xob. Ua tau zoo absorbs thiab lim cov high-siv ripple tam sim no generated los ntawm lub cev muaj zog tsav, zoo tiv thaiv tus actuator, kom ntseeg tau tias tsis tu ncua thiab ruaj khov ua hauj lwm, thiab zoo suppressing voltage fluctuations los ntawm cuam tshuam nrog ib puag ncig rhiab Cheebtsam.
Kub-kub Resistance
4000 teev ntawm kev pab cuam lub neej ntawm 135 ° C thiab txhawb nqa hnyav ambient kub txog 150 ° C; yooj yim withstands harshest ua hauj lwm nruab nrab kub nyob rau hauv lub engine compartment.
Kev ntseeg siab
Piv nrog rau VHU series, VHE series muaj kev txhim kho overload thiab poob siab tsis kam, ua kom ruaj khov ua haujlwm nyob rau hauv lub sijhawm dhau los lossis poob siab. Nws cov nqi zoo heev thiab kev tawm tsam tawm tau yooj yim yoog rau cov xwm txheej ua haujlwm zoo xws li nquag pib-nres thiab on-off cycles, kom ntseeg tau lub neej ntev.
Kev ntseeg tau cov ntaub ntawv pov thawj & xaiv cov lus pom zoo
Cov ntaub ntawv ntsuam xyuas qhia tau hais tias VHE series tshaj cov neeg sib tw thoob ntiaj teb hauv ntau qhov ntsuas kev ua tau zoo:
ESR txo mus rau 8-9mΩ (ib txwm);
Ripple tam sim no muaj peev xwm ncav cuag 3500mA ntawm 135 ° C;
Surge voltage tiv taus mus txog 44V;
Capacitance thiab ESR variation raug txo kom tsawg tshaj qhov kub ntau.
